The Beneteau Flyer 9 Sundeck is a modern take on the versatile day boat, designed for boaters who want a combination of comfort, smart use of space, and a manageable size. With its sleek profile and thoughtfully laid-out deck, the Flyer 9 Sundeck has become a favorite among families and couples looking for an accessible entry into the cruising lifestyle. At just under 30 feet, it packs in more than you might expect—offering sunbathing areas, a cabin with overnight accommodations, and the performance of twin outboards.
Unlike larger luxury center consoles or yachts that focus primarily on offshore power, the Flyer 9 Sundeck emphasizes lifestyle. It is built for enjoying sunny days on the water, easy overnight trips, and effortless handling for new and experienced boaters alike. This makes it a strong contender in the mid-size day cruiser market, where practicality and fun are equally important.

Unlike some performance-focused boats that demand advanced skills, the Flyer 9 Sundeck is forgiving to handle and less intimidating for those still building confidence at the helm. Beneteau is known for its smart use of space, and the Flyer 9 Sundeck is no exception.
- Cruise Speed: 22–28 knots for efficiency and comfort
- Hull Design: Air Step® 2 hull for improved lift and fuel efficiency
- Cabin: Sleeps 2 adults comfortably with enclosed head and galley space
- Seating Layout: Forward sundeck, starboard side walkway, aft L-shaped seating with convertible backrest
The asymmetric walkway is a standout feature, providing easy and safe access to the bow without eating up interior cabin space. The wide beam enhances stability, while the Air Step® hull design improves performance and keeps fuel consumption in check.
On-Water PerformancePerformance is balanced rather than extreme. With twin 250 HP outboards, the Flyer 9 Sundeck offers smooth acceleration and reliable cruising speeds. Handling is predictable and light, making it an easy boat to dock or maneuver even in tighter spaces. For coastal cruising, it’s more than capable.
Where it shines is in comfort underway. The hull absorbs chop effectively, keeping passengers dry and relaxed. At cruising speeds, the boat remains efficient, with fuel consumption that makes regular use affordable.
Safety ConsiderationsBeneteau has designed the Flyer 9 Sundeck with family safety in mind. High rails around the bow sunpad, wide and clear walkways, and secure seating make movement around the boat comfortable even for children or older passengers. The enclosed head is a practical addition for longer trips, reducing the need for frequent stops.
The Flyer 9 Sundeck is loaded with thoughtful features that enhance every outing. The aft bench seat converts easily, creating multiple lounge or dining setups. The forward sundeck is expansive for its size, giving passengers a true “beach club” vibe onboard. Inside, the cabin includes a small galley, enclosed head, and sleeping arrangements, making it possible to turn a day trip into an overnight escape.
Technology is also up to date. The helm supports digital displays, GPS, and autopilot options, making navigation straightforward. Premium upholstery and finishes, along with optional extras like a T-top or extended swim platforms.
